Steak Pizziola is a traditional Italian meal.  The meat is tender and juicy and the sauce is delicious.
 
Ingredients
2-3 Lbs Chuck steak, Sirloin Steak
or any steak of your choice
1 (28-ounce) can Italian tomatoes
   – crushed (Preferably San Marzano)
2 TBSP Extra Virgin Olive Oil
2 Garlic Cloves – finely minced
¼ tsp Red Pepper Flakes
1 tsp Oregano
1 tsp Salt
1 tsp Black Pepper
 
Instructions
Preheat oven to 350º.  Season steaks on both sides with salt and pepper.  In a cast iron skillet (or one that can go into the oven), sear the steaks on both sides.  Set aside.  In the skillet, add the tomatoes, garlic, red pepper flakes and oregano.  Stir scraping all the bits left over from the steak. Put the steak back into the skillet and place in the oven for 1 – 1½ hours, or until the steaks are tender.   Spoon the sauce over the steak to serve.  The sauce can also be used over pasta or rice.
